Comparison of photometric precision in two fields of NGC 330 captured during the nights of 17 and 19 December 2008. Three upper panels: photometric errors from DAOPHOT for V, (b − y) and m1 (black points for the field from the first night, gray from the second). Three bottom panels: differences in metallicities determined for the first and second field for clusters, and old and young field giants, respectively.
